  • Base neck fill. Excellent cork. Clear deep blood-ruby-brick red. Evolved savory bouquet of game, tobacco, camphor, plum, and scorched earth. Medium bodied, mellow, seamless, with tart red fruit still hanging in there. Better than a previous bottle. Cooler serving temperature helps this wine. Held up nicely after 24 hours under vacuum stopper.

  • "Estate Bottled." Base neck fill. Capsule and cork in perfect condition. Poured and tasted. Clear, deep blood-ruby-garnet. Aromas and flavors of saddle soap, fennel, au jus viande, and stewed red fruit. Has that "generic old red wine" quality -- it reminds me of a 1973 gran reserva tempranillo tasted recently. The fact that this wine is drinkable at all, not to mention enjoyable, comes as a delightful surprise.
